IoT Will Transform the Retail Industry: Here’s How

Retail Next

Demand-based warehouse fulfillment. RFID allows retailers to monitor the location and movement of product, and coupled with POS systems for online and in-store sales, allows inventories to be readily available at stores and shipping locations to ensure items in high demand are never out of stock.
